Główna » jak » Jak korzystać z ADB i Fastboot na Chromebooku

    Jak korzystać z ADB i Fastboot na Chromebooku

    Przez długi czas użytkownicy Chromebooków, którzy potrzebują dostępu do narzędzi Android Debug Utility (ADB) i Fastboot na urządzenia z Androidem, mieli jedną opcję: Crouton. Teraz jednak zarówno ADB, jak i Fastboot są uwzględnione w systemie operacyjnym Chrome. Oto, jak uzyskać do nich dostęp.

    Po pierwsze: urządzenie musi znajdować się w trybie programisty

    Po pierwsze: ADB i Fastboot są technicznie uważane za narzędzia "programistyczne", więc Twój Chromebook musi być w trybie programisty, zanim będziesz mieć do nich dostęp. Aby to wyjaśnić, nie mówimy o programistach kanał tutaj - każdy Chromebook może być ustawiony w pewien rodzaj "odblokowanego" trybu, który pozwala na głębszy dostęp do systemu i ulepszenia. Nazywa się to trybem programisty.

    Na szczęście włączenie trybu deweloperskiego jest bardzo proste i proste. Jest jednak jedno zastrzeżenie: urządzenie powtarza się, więc musisz zacząć od nowa. Dobra wiadomość jest taka, że ​​to Chromebook, więc to naprawdę nie powinno zająć tyle czasu.

    Jeśli Ci się spodoba, skorzystaj z naszego przewodnika po włączeniu trybu programisty. To powinno Cię zmusić do przejścia i gotowe do działania w ciągu kilku minut.

    Po drugie: Get Your Crosh On

    Aby korzystać z ADB i Fastboot na Chromebooku, musisz użyć czegoś zwanego skrótem Crosh do "Chrome Shell". Pomyśl o tym jako o lekkim terminalu tylko dla systemu operacyjnego Chrome.

    Istnieje kilka sposobów na dostęp do Crosha. Aby otworzyć go w pełnym oknie przeglądarki, naciśnij Ctrl + Alt + T na klawiaturze.

    Jeśli jednak dość często używasz Crosha i chcesz go użyć w wyskakującym okienku (jak "prawdziwy" terminal), potrzebujesz dwóch rozszerzeń: Secure Shell i Crosh Window. Po zainstalowaniu, będziesz mieć wpis Crosh w szufladzie aplikacji, który uruchamia Crosh w miłym, czystym małym okienku. Osobiście jest to moja preferowana metoda używania Crosha.

    Po uruchomieniu okna Crosh jesteś gotowy do rock and rolla. Nie możesz jednak po prostu przejść bezpośrednio do ADB i Fastboot, musisz najpierw wprowadzić jedno polecenie, aby najpierw uzyskać okno powłoki. Wpisz następujące polecenie:

    muszla

    Monit powinien zmienić się na "chronos @ localhost", po którym ADB i Fastboot powinny być dostępne tak, jak normalnie.

    Opcjonalnie: co, jeśli to nie działa?

    Kiedy pierwszy raz to testowałem, nie mogłem go uruchomić. ADB widział moje urządzenia z Androidem, ale nigdy nie żądał dostępu. Okazuje się, że Chrome wciąż działa stara wersja ABD / Fastboot (bo Google, prawda?), Więc musisz ją zaktualizować.

    Ale tu pojawia się problem: nie można tak po prostu zaktualizować ADB i Fastboot jak na normalnym komputerze. Istnieje jednak rozwiązanie. Jeśli masz Chromebooka z procesorem Intel, istnieje skrypt, który zaktualizuje ADB i Fastboot do najnowszych wersji, a także przeniesie je do "właściwej" lokalizacji. Potem wszystko powinno działać dobrze.

    Sam skrypt jest dość prosty, a wszystkie instrukcje są publikowane na stronie GitHub. Sugerujemy przeczytanie ich przed rozpoczęciem, abyś wiedział dokładnie, co dzieje się za kulisami. Wszystko jest również open source, więc jeśli chcesz przejrzeć kod, możesz to zrobić.

    Po zaktualizowaniu i przeniesieniu ADB i Fastboot oba polecenia powinny działać bezbłędnie. Przetestowałem to na Pixelbooku (i5, programisty) poprzez flashowanie zapasowej pamięci ROM na moim Nexusie 6 i było idealnie.